Witness Appeal: Assault of a Man - Arklow, Co. Wicklow - 2nd August 2022

Issue Date: 5th August 2022

Gardaí investigating the assault of a man in Co. Wicklow, on Tuesday morning are appealing for witnesses.

At approximately 2:30am on Tuesday 2nd August 2022, Gardaí were alerted to an assault that occurred at a property in the Ashfield estate, Arklow, Co. Wicklow.

A man in his 40s was discovered with wounds to his head. He was later taken to St Vincent’s Hospital to be treated for his injuries before being later transferred to Beaumont Hospital where his condition is described as critical.

Gardaí are appealing for witnesses to come forward. They are keen to speak to anyone who was in the area from 12:30 – 2:30am on Tuesday morning, who may have witnessed anything to come forward. They are particularly keen that anyone who may have camera footage from this area at this time (including dash-cam) to make this available to investigating Gardaí.
